I figured a few of you Royal Purple guys would like to see this :confused: Thanks to Blackstone at least I know the Amsoil is worth it.

2003 GMC Sierra ExCab 5.3

10k miles

Same filter on those 10k miles

No oil added

The oil actually looked really good when I changed it.

No bad smell and it still had a slight golden color to it.

Overall I was impressed

Amsoil = Happy Truck :confused:
